Universal Pictures are due to release the 2021 supernatural horror The Black Phone on Blu-ray and DVD this October in the UK.
Directed by Scott Derrickson, the film stars Mason Thames, Madeleine McGraw, Jeremy Davies, James Ransone and Ethan Hawke.

The Black Phone Blu-ray & DVD
This one is available on either blu-ray or DVD but there’s no word on what if any extras are included.
Blu-ray Technical Specs
- Discs: 1
- Region Code: B
- Picture: 1080p HD
- Aspect Ratio: 2.39:1
- Audio: DTS-HD Master Audio 7.1
- Running Time: 102 mins approx
- Language: English

Release Date
Both Blu-ray & DVD release 3rd October 2022 in the UK.
